Quigg, Quigg v. Treadway, Grotecloss, Quinlan

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Second Department
Jan 1, 1927
219 App. Div. 735 (N.Y. App. Div. 1927)

Opinion

January, 1927.

Present — Kelly, P.J., Jaycox, Manning, Kapper and Lazansky, JJ.


Motion to dismiss appeal dismissed, without costs. Affirmance of the order, as modified, in Quigg v. Treadway ( post, p. 739), decided herewith, renders unnecessary a determination of this motion.
